Pop Artist James Rizzi Dies Aged 61

Brooklyn-born US pop artist James Rizzi has died peacefully in his sleep at the age of 61.

The artist, best known for his bright, cartoon-like drawings and 3D designs, created the cover for the first album of the band Tom Tom Club and was the official artist for the 1996 Summer Olympics in Atlanta.

Alexander Lieventhal, of Art 28 GmbH & Co in Stuttgart, Germany, which buys and sells Rizzi’s work, said he had suffered a heart condition and had died on Monday.
